Hi Tyler

Check your cables / Confirm that they are properly seated.
Check the pins in the plugins. If they are bended or broken, a new cable might be in order.
Check that your Graphic card is properly seated

try use another known working monitor if you have one, or borrow one for a short time.
See if you can re-produce the behaviour. If yes, then you probably can exclude a faltering
monitor.
